Nana Kwakye Asamoah currently serves as a Merchant Relations Officer in Digital Banking at Guaranty Trust Bank (Ghana) Limited since October 2021 and has been a National Service Personnel at the same organization. In addition, Nana holds the position of Head of Sales and Marketing at Body Bass GH since December 2020 and previously served as 2nd Deputy Speaker for the Valco Hall Parliamentary Council. At the University of Cape Coast, Nana acted as the Deputy Chairperson of the Students Audit Committee and held an industrial attachment at Absa Group. Leadership roles include President of the St. Peter's Old Boys Association - UCC Chapter, SRC Representative 3 at Valco Hall, and Membership Coordinator of The Student's Leadership Club. Furthermore, Nana was the Chairperson for the Valco Hall Publicity Committee, and earlier experience includes being a Sales Assistant at Cap Noble Agency. Nana obtained a Bachelor of Commerce in Finance from the University of Cape Coast between 2017 and 2021, following education at St. Peter's Senior High School from 2012 to 2015.

Guaranty Trust Bank (Ghana) Limited (GTBank) is a leading universal bank in Ghana providing unparalleled banking products and services to retail, corporate, commercial and SME customers. The Bank is the largest subsidiary of Guaranty Trust Bank Plc, one of the foremost banks in Nigeria with a Triple A rating; the first indigenously owned sub-Saharan bank to be quoted on the London Stock Exchange. GTBank was registered in Ghana in October 2004 and obtained its universal banking license from the Bank of Ghana on February 23, 2006. GTBank operates from 33 branches across the country and is the industry leader in digital and electronic banking having won multiple awards for its innovativeness and superior offering. These awards include the ICSA Best Digital Bank Award for 2019, Best Digital Banking Award for 2018 and 2017, Ghana Information Technology and Telecommunication Awards’ Technology Advanced Bank of the Year” for 2014, 2015, 2016 and 2017.
